CT12 6AT is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on Winifred Avenue, 0.3km from Whitehall in Ramsgate. Administratively it sits within Northwood ward and the South Thanet constituency.

An affordable area with active regeneration, CT12 6AT is a transitional terrace area — improving but still facing economic pressures. Outside of residential hours, mainly white, agricultural workforce, on the edges of smaller towns. At 39 years average, expect a well-rounded neighbourhood — a blend of established families, working professionals, and longer-term owner-occupiers. 37% of homes are socially rented, reflecting the area's public housing provision and council presence. Full-time employment stands at 25% — below average for the region, consistent with the area's higher deprivation indicators.

Safety: Crime is moderate at 72 incidents per 1,000 residents — broadly typical for this type of urban area. Property: Average house prices are around £223k, up 65.2% year-on-year.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.

Census 2021 statistics for CT12 6AT are sourced from Output Area E00125307 (shared with 7 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
